Cintas is seeking a Production Associate – Garment/Linen/Bulk Product Folder - 3rd Shift - Up To $23/Hour to support the Rental Division. The Product Folder is responsible for folding customer product manually or through the use of an industrial garment folding machine, counting folded product, and preparing bundles of clean, folded product for delivery to customers.

Cintas is seeking a Warehouse Associate - Washroom Operator - 3rd Shift to support the Rental Division. The Washroom Operator is responsible for safely and accurately loading and unloading customer garments and bulk products into industrial washers and dryers using washroom equipment to set appropriate wash and dry parameters based on product type.

How to Pass a Personality Test with Flying Colors
Whether you’re applying for your first job or looking to move up the career ladder, personality tests aren’t usually the first thing we think about. But surprisingly, they can have a massive impact on how our future employers perceive us. In fact, a 2017 study by the Society for Human Resource Management (SHRM) has found that 32% of U.S. employers use personality tests when hiring for senior management positions, and 28% use them for middle management positions. Personality tests are also used for hourly workers and contractors, though less frequently.
Virtual Reality Job Interviews
With the advent of desktop computers, the arduous task of scouring through weekly job classifieds became a thing of the past. The mid-1990s brought about a new era where job seekers could easily search and apply for jobs online. The introduction of AOL's Instant Messaging feature provided an even faster means for employers and candidates to communicate and schedule interviews. As smartphones became more pervasive in the early 2000s, hiring managers increasingly used phone calls for screening and interviewing candidates. Despite this trend, over 80% of interviews still took place in person.
